Web1 INTRODUCTION. Healthcare delivery requires the coordinated effort of an interprofessional team. Effective coordination involves the sequencing and timing of tasks to minimize delays, omissions and wasted effort (Kozlowski & Ilgen, 2006).Coordination can be implicit through team members performing their roles in synchronicity or explicit …

WebInterprofessional Practice and Team Functioning . Team functioning describes how team members act and work together. It includes the qualities, behaviours and processes , particularly interprofessional education (IPE), required to support and sustain team collaboration, cohesiveness and resilience.
